General Staff: Armed Forces of Ukraine struck oil facilities in Ryazan and a command post in the Kursk region.


The Armed Forces of Ukraine and the Main Intelligence Directorate struck the Ryazan Oil Refinery, one of the largest oil refineries in Russia. As a result of the attack, explosions and a fire occurred on the facility's territory.
According to the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, as of January 26, the attacked refinery is involved in supplying the Russian occupying army, in particular, it produces diesel fuel and jet fuel TS-1.
There are also reports of damage to the forward command post of the Pacific Fleet operational group near the settlement of Koryenevo in the Kursk region. The scale of the damage is currently being clarified.
The General Staff emphasizes that combat operations against the enemy's command posts and important facilities that supply the aggressor's army will continue.
